1. Reclaimed Wood Shiplap Accent Wall

Rustic boho farmhouse living room with reclaimed wood shiplap accent wall, macramé hangings, and dried pampas grass in golden light.

Nothing anchors a boho farmhouse room quite like a shiplap accent wall crafted from reclaimed wood. The natural knots, varied tones, and weathered grain tell a story of age and authenticity that no paint color can replicate. Whether you install it behind a sofa or in a dining nook, the texture adds instant depth and warmth. Pair it with chunky linen cushions, dried florals, and a vintage rug to complete the look.

The beauty of reclaimed shiplap is how it bridges rustic and bohemian effortlessly. The raw, organic quality of aged wood plays beautifully against softer boho elements like woven wall art and layered textiles. 3. Dried Pampas Grass and Botanical Arrangements

Rustic boho farmhouse entryway featuring a terracotta vase with dried pampas grass and wild botanicals against whitewashed walls.

Dried pampas grass has become the unofficial mascot of boho farmhouse interiors, and for very good reason. Its feathery plumes bring movement, softness, and an almost sculptural quality to a room without requiring any maintenance. Arrange a generous bundle in an oversized terracotta or ceramic vase and place it in a corner, entryway, or beside a fireplace for that signature layered, nature-inspired look that dominates Pinterest home boards.

Beyond pampas grass, dried botanicals like bunny tail grass, wheat stems, eucalyptus, and globe thistles add variety and visual interest. Mixing textures and heights within a single arrangement creates a lush, gathered-from-the-meadow feel. 5. Vintage Wooden Crates and Repurposed Storage

Rustic boho farmhouse kitchen corner with stacked vintage wooden crates as open shelving filled with jars, dried herbs, and potted plants.

Vintage wooden crates are one of those magical decor elements that are both deeply functional and visually beautiful. Stack them as open shelving in a kitchen, use them as side tables in a living room, or arrange them in a bedroom for a rustic, effortless storage solution. The worn wood grain, faded paint, and aged edges bring the character and imperfection that define a genuinely charming farmhouse aesthetic. This idea consistently goes viral on Pinterest because it looks expensive while being budget-friendly.

The art is in the styling. Fill your crates with woven baskets, glass apothecary jars, rolled linen napkins, small terracotta pots, and clusters of dried herbs for that abundant, thoughtfully collected feel. Stagger the crates at different angles to create dynamic visual interest on a wall. 10. Whitewashed Stone Fireplace with Boho Mantel Styling

Cozy boho farmhouse living room with whitewashed stone fireplace and wood mantel styled with pampas grass, candles, vintage mirror, and terracotta vases.

A whitewashed stone fireplace is the ultimate statement piece in a boho farmhouse home. The whitewash technique lightens the stone while preserving all of its beautiful natural texture — creating that romantic, old-world European farmhouse feel that pairs so naturally with bohemian styling. If you’re working with an existing brick or stone fireplace, a whitewash treatment is a surprisingly accessible DIY project that can completely transform the heart of your home.

The mantel is where your boho farmhouse personality truly shines. Layer it with a large vintage or distressed mirror as the anchor, then cluster pampas grass in terracotta vases, a grouping of pillar candles at varying heights, a small stack of artful books, and a trailing plant or two. Leave intentional breathing room between elements — the restraint is what makes it look curated rather than cluttered.
